Transaction

e43f5f7cfcea91c3ad3eaf2f2df2aafc4207fe68ff5390c066e08e03e8db075c
552,332 confirmations
Timestamp
1446450493
Block381,674
Fee10,000 sats
Fee rate26.9 sats/vB
view on mempool.space

Inputs & Outputs